草庐IT

Java unicode 字体

全部标签

android - 在android中更改文本编辑错误通知字体

我知道我们可以使用Typeface更改编辑文本的字体。但是我们为编辑文本设置的错误呢?看下面的代码:Typefacefont=Typeface.createFromAsset(getAssets(),"fonts/ATaha.ttf");privateEditTextmPasswordView;mPasswordView=(EditText)findViewById(R.id.password);mPasswordView.setTypeface(font);使用这段代码我只能更改编辑文本字体但是当我设置错误时是这样的:mPasswordView.setError(getString(

Android:如何从代码更改应用程序字体大小

我有一个要求,我需要根据用户提供的值更改应用程序字体大小。我怎样才能做到这一点?我已经用谷歌搜索了,但似乎这只能通过XML布局来完成。 最佳答案 你可以改变TextView的文本大小textview.setTextSize(int_value);这是你的意思吗? 关于Android:如何从代码更改应用程序字体大小,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/6162222/

android - 忽略 ICS 的字体大小设置

我有一个Android应用程序,如果用户将他们的字体大小设置为大或超大(通过设置->显示->IceCreamSandwich中的字体大小),它看起来非常糟糕。很明显,它不是为可变字体大小设计的,它使很多文本变得不可读。我见过为大多数View保留字体大小的应用程序,所以我知道必须有一种方法可以做到这一点。有没有一种简单的方法可以告诉应用程序忽略用户的字体大小偏好?如果没有,您会建议我如何计算字体大小?如果不出意外,有没有办法让我检索用户的字体大小偏好? 最佳答案 我想你想要做的是以“dp”而不是“sp”指定你的字体大小。所有sp单位在

Android remoteViews自定义字体

如何在我的小部件中设置自定义字体?remoteViews.setTextViewText(R.id.text1,""+days);谁能告诉我如何为此设置字体的示例? 最佳答案 HowIcansetcustomfontinmywidget?你不知道。您可以通过android:typeface在您的布局XML中选择三种内置字体之一,但您不能在RemoteViews中使用带有TextView的自定义字体。setTypeface()是用于在TextView上指定自定义字体的Java方法,不适用于RemoteViews。

android - 如何在 RN for Android 中禁用字体缩放?

只需使用allowFontScaling={false}即可在iOS上修复此问题,但我不确定如何在Android上进行设置。此外,对于不熟悉RN并且从Android标签来到这里的任何人,我不认为我可以轻松地更改为dp字体缩放或其他任何东西,所以有没有办法我可以通过某种方式在我的应用程序中全局执行此操作吗?谢谢! 最佳答案 请更新ManiApplication.java文件importandroid.view.WindowManager;importandroid.content.res.Configuration;importand

Android 在菜单项中使用 font-awesome 字体作为图标

我只是在学习android,很抱歉我缺乏这方面的知识。我主要是一名Web开发人员,我们一直使用FontAwesome,所以我试图让它与Android一起工作。我第一次发现我可以使用很棒的字体here.通过更深入的搜索,我发现了如何在标题here的操作菜单栏中放置一个很棒的字体图标。.我错过了在有空间时通过设置标题而不是图标和标题来拥有备份文本的能力。我想知道我是否可以将图标设置为awesome字体而不是标题,并且标题只有正常的描述性文本。当我在菜单项上执行setIcon方法时,它需要一个可绘制或可绘制资源ID。我可以将它转换为可绘制对象吗?保持图标的字体很棒并同时拥有图标和标题的最佳方

android - XML 中的字体 android :fontFamily is not applied to toolbars

我正在使用新的XML字体功能,该功能是在Android8.0Oreo中引入的,支持库26.1.0。通过在应用程序主题内设置android:fontFamily属性来应用整个应用程序的默认字体系列:...@font/proxima_nova该字体已正确应用于应用程序中除工具栏之外的所有View。所有工具栏都继续使用Roboto字体:更新:该问题似乎已在支持库27.0.0中得到修复。我无法再复制它。 最佳答案 我还没有在所有Android版本上进行测试,但这似乎可行:...@font/proxima_nova@style/AppThem

Android:如何设置应用程序范围的默认字体,而不覆盖 textAppearance

我在我的Android应用程序中使用自定义字体。我想将此自定义字体设置为应用程序默认字体(作为回退),但我仍然想使用TextViewtextAppearance属性来设置字体和文本样式。它看起来像在我的应用程序基本主题中设置textViewStyle或fontFamily,allays覆盖TextViewtextAppearance样式?@font/open_sans@style/DefaultTextAppearancenormal@font/open_sans_regularnormal@font/open_sans_extra_bold 最佳答案

java - 更改 AlertDialog 中的字体

有人可以建议一种在动态创建的AlertDialog(标题和正文中)中更改字体的方法吗?我尝试了很多方法,但都没有用。代码是:publicvoidonClick(Viewv){newAlertDialog.Builder(c).setTitle(data.eqselect)//.set.setIcon(R.drawable.icon).setMessage(Threads.myData[0]).setNegativeButton("Close",newDialogInterface.OnClickListener(){publicvoidonClick(DialogInterfacedi

微信小程序引入字体在部分机型失效不兼容解决办法

写小程序页面,美工作图用了特殊字体引入代码:@font-face{font-family:'huxiaobo';src:url("https://xxxxxxxx.top/assets/fonts/huxiaobonanshenti.woff")}.font-loaded{font-family:"huxiaobo";}上线后发现部分安卓机型不兼容,查资料发现荣耀和vivo需要设置正确的CORS即可正常加载。字体链接访问需满足浏览器同源策略,字体文件资源设置CORS的Access-Control-Allow-Origin为小程序域名:servicewechat.com或者*才可以解决办法:修改